summ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orjnanar2018-06-03 22:05:52 +0200
committerjnanar2018-06-03 22:05:52 +0200
commit94818215670530cec6c1d905880435c836503d8f (patch)
treed03e9aaa50a2c358cea4dfe462ae22f16658ba98
parent78f5242170b87536b3c88bf2ce7ce76039a9f320 (diff)
downloadaur-94818215670530cec6c1d905880435c836503d8f.tar.gz
cosmetics changes
-rw-r--r--PKGBUILD67
1 files changed, 32 insertions, 35 deletions
diff --git a/PKGBUILD b/PKGBUILD
index b17506cc6754..6ad64c7671da 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,7 +1,7 @@
#Maintainer: jnanar <info@agayon.be>
-pkgbase='sat-libervia-hg'
-pkgname=('sat-libervia-hg')
+pkgname='sat-libervia-hg'
+pkgbase=$pkgname
_realname=libervia
_pyjamasname=pyjamas
venv_pyjama='venv'
@@ -10,12 +10,12 @@ VERSION=0.6.1
pkgrel=1
url="http://salut-a-toi.org/"
arch=('any')
-depends=('python2' 'python2-txjsonrpc-git' 'python2-jinja' 'python2-shortuuid-git' 'sat-media-hg' 'sat-xmpp-hg' 'sat-templates-hg' 'python2-zope-interface' 'python2-pyopenssl' 'python2-autobahn' 'dbus')
-makedepends=('python2-setuptools' 'python-virtualenv' 'mercurial')
+depends=('python2' 'python2-txjsonrpc-git' 'python2-jinja' 'python2-shortuuid-git' 'sat-media-hg' 'sat-xmpp-hg' 'sat-templates-hg' 'python2-zope-interface' 'python2-pyopenssl' 'python2-autobahn' 'dbus')
+makedepends=('python2-setuptools' 'python2-virtualenv' 'mercurial')
license=('AGPL3')
install=$pkgbase.install
-source=('ftp://ftp.goffi.org/pyjamas/pyjamas.tar.bz2'
- "hg+http://repos.goffi.org/libervia"
+source=('https://ftp.goffi.org/pyjamas/pyjamas.tar.bz2'
+ "hg+https://repos.goffi.org/libervia"
)
md5sums=('a0d6344951153f79302eb2b6fd08376e'
@@ -25,51 +25,48 @@ md5sums=('a0d6344951153f79302eb2b6fd08376e'
options=('!strip')
pkgver() {
- cd "$_realname"
- printf "$VERSION.r%s.%s" "$(hg identify -n)" "$(hg identify -i)"
+ cd "$_realname"
+ printf "$VERSION.r%s.%s" "$(hg identify -n)" "$(hg identify -i)"
}
-
pyjamas_build(){
virtualenv $venv_pyjama -ppython2.7 --system-site-packages
cd $_pyjamasname
- source $srcdir/$venv_pyjama/bin/activate
+ source $srcdir/$venv_pyjama/bin/activate
python2.7 bootstrap.py
deactivate
}
-
+
build() {
pyjamas_build
cd "$srcdir/$_realname"
- install -dm755 "$srcdir/fakeinstall/"
+# install -dm755 "$srcdir/fakeinstall/"
PYJSBUILD_PATH="$srcdir/pyjamas/bin/"
PATH=$PATH:$PYJSBUILD_PATH LIBERVIA_INSTALL=arch NO_PREINSTALL_OPT=nopreinstall SAT_INSTALL=nopreinstall python2 setup.py install --root="$srcdir/fakeinstall/" --prefix=/usr --optimize=1
cp -r $srcdir/$_realname/src/{browser,pages,common,server,twisted} $srcdir/fakeinstall/usr/lib/python2.7/site-packages/libervia
}
-package_sat-libervia-hg(){
- pkgdesc="Salut à Toi, multi-frontends multi-purposes XMPP client (Web interface)"
- provides=('sat-libervia')
- conflicts=('sat-libervia')
- cd "$pkgdir"
- install -dm755 usr/bin
- install -dm755 usr/lib/python2.7/site-packages
- install -dm755 usr/share/doc
- install -dm755 usr/share/libervia
- install -dm755 usr/lib/python2.7/site-packages/twisted/plugins
- # HTML destination
- install -dm755 usr/share/libervia/html
- cd "$srcdir/fakeinstall"
- cp "$srcdir/libervia/src/libervia.sh" "$pkgdir/usr/bin/libervia"
- mv -v usr/share/doc/libervia "$pkgdir/usr/share/doc/"
- mv -v usr/share/libervia "$pkgdir/usr/share/libervia/"
- mv -v usr/lib/python2.7/site-packages/libervia "$pkgdir/usr/lib/python2.7/site-packages/"
- mv -v usr/lib/python2.7/site-packages/libervia-0.6.1.1-py2.7.egg-info "$pkgdir/usr/lib/python2.7/site-packages/"
- mv -v usr/lib/python2.7/site-packages/twisted/plugins/* "$pkgdir/usr/lib/python2.7/site-packages/twisted/plugins/"
- mv -v "$srcdir/libervia/html" "$pkgdir/usr/share/libervia/"
- mv -v "$srcdir/libervia/themes" "$pkgdir/usr/share/libervia"
-
-
+package(){
+ pkgdesc="Salut à Toi, multi-frontends multi-purposes XMPP client (Web interface)"
+ provides=('sat-libervia')
+ conflicts=('sat-libervia')
+ cd "$pkgdir"
+ install -dm755 usr/bin
+ install -dm755 usr/lib/python2.7/site-packages
+ install -dm755 usr/share/doc
+ install -dm755 usr/share/libervia
+ install -dm755 usr/lib/python2.7/site-packages/twisted/plugins
+ # HTML destination
+ install -dm755 usr/share/libervia/html
+ cd "$srcdir/fakeinstall"
+ cp "$srcdir/libervia/src/libervia.sh" "$pkgdir/usr/bin/libervia"
+ mv -v usr/share/doc/libervia "$pkgdir/usr/share/doc/"
+ mv -v usr/share/libervia "$pkgdir/usr/share/libervia/"
+ mv -v usr/lib/python2.7/site-packages/libervia "$pkgdir/usr/lib/python2.7/site-packages/"
+ mv -v usr/lib/python2.7/site-packages/libervia-0.6.1.1-py2.7.egg-info "$pkgdir/usr/lib/python2.7/site-packages/"
+ mv -v usr/lib/python2.7/site-packages/twisted/plugins/* "$pkgdir/usr/lib/python2.7/site-packages/twisted/plugins/"
+ mv -v "$srcdir/libervia/html" "$pkgdir/usr/share/libervia/"
+ mv -v "$srcdir/libervia/themes" "$pkgdir/usr/share/libervia"
}